Do at least notify your card company so that they'll know not to kick in their automatic anti-fraud alerts and freeze your card unexpectedly. Also, you might be able to ask them to put a daily limit on your card usage just to limit the damage in case someone does get their hands on your info.

Also, before you leave, write down all the phone numbers and email addresses of your financial institutions in case you do need to contact them. It seems like a small thing, but sometimes finding that information without the original cards or an internet connection can be time-consuming and frustrating.
